2009-2010 COMMUNITY PROJECTS The Junior League will give $43.240 and 36,000 volunteer hours to the following community projects this year: - Amarillo Museum of Art
- Hope and Healing Place
- Rainbow Connection at Child Protective Services
- Teen Court
- Northwest Texas Hospital Child Life Program
- Camp Alphie
- Kids Cafe / High Plains Food Bank
COMMUNITY ASSISTANCE FUNDS
The Junior League will grant a total of $15,000 to area agencies.
ACE SCHOLARSHIP PROGRAM The Junior League of Amarillo gave $50,000 to the initial ACE scholarship fund for Palo Duro HIgh School. Recently, the League completed an additional $50,000 grant to the initial ACE scholarship fund at Caprock High School.
The Junior League currently has three ACE Housing and DIning Scholarship students. Each young lady receives $5,000 per year towards their housing and ining expenses at West Texas A&M University.
MEDICAL CENTER LEAGUE HOUSE The Junior League is developing plans to build the Medical Center League House. This facility will be a home away from home for families with loved ones in the hospital as well as patients receiving out-patient care.
